Workers are connected by a social network through which job information can be transmitted among them. The case of single-step transmission of job information has been discussed by Calvó-Armengol and Zenou (2005) and they found a positive effect and a negative effect when examining the impact...

We analyze strategic speculators' incentives to trade on information in a model where firm value is endogenous to trading, due to feedback from the financial market to corporate decisions. Trading reveals private information to managers and improves their real decisions, enhancing fundamental...
